About The Position

The Athletic Director is responsible for planning, scheduling, coordinating, and managing supervision for all athletics events involving KIPP San Francisco College Preparatory. The Athletic Director operates in compliance with the state regulating agency, operational direction of KIPP Northern California Public Schools leadership, section and state athletics governing body bylaws, and state and local regulatory agencies. The AD supports the principal in implementing the school’s Cultural Vision and fosters a culture of high expectations. They also build strong partnerships with families and the community, and create a safe environment that welcomes, reflects, and supports the diversity of the student population and communities served. All Athletic Directors serve in an instructional capacity unique to their school setting, and all KIPP educators hold the following values as part of their practice: Teach with Purpose, Support and Collaboration, and Commitment to Anti-Racism.

Responsibilities

  • Organizes and administers the program of interscholastic athletics
  • Maintains a positive, warm, inclusive, rigorous, and engaging classroom environment that incorporates Restorative Practices and Social Emotional Learning.
  • Implements culturally responsive classroom management strategies to create a safe environment for all students to learn & achieve.
  • Communicates regularly with staff, students, families, and other key stakeholders to ensure strong partnerships.
  • Attends and engages in weekly Professional Development and other Communities of Practice to continue learning and growing as an educator.
  • Updates student records regularly, including attendance, grades, behavior data, etc.
  • Supervises Fall Sports: Girls Volleyball, Girls Soccer, Cross Country
  • Supervises Winter Sports: Girls Basketball, Boys Basketball
  • Supervises Spring Sports: Boys Soccer, Baseball, Track & Field, Boys Volleyball
  • Supervises Year-Round Program: Cheerleading
  • Trains, hires, and professionally develops coaches
  • Facilitates the recruitment and selection of coaches, as well as supervision and support
  • Establishes and executes a program of Professional Development for the coaching staff
  • Manages external coaches HR items and pay (onboarding, approving timesheets, ensuring compliance items are completed, etc.)
  • Assists coaches in developing academic interventions in alignment with KIPP policies and enforces academic expectations set forth by the CIF
  • In collaboration with head coaches, schedules all interscholastic athletics events, inclusive of contests and practices and matches the competitive level of the teams
  • Manages all administrative aspects of athletic programming
  • Manages the distribution and collection of uniforms and equipment
  • Establishes supervision policies and practices for athletic facilities
  • Coordinates with outside groups and the city for off-site facilities rentals as needed
  • Adheres to federal, state, league and school regulations governing programming and participation:
  • Develops and updates the Department Handbook for staff, parents, and student-athletes which includes setting and communicating vision of the program
  • Keeps records of all interscholastic contests and sport-specific performance records
  • Prepares and administers the Athletics Department budget and fundraising efforts (tracks all spending, makes sure funds are distributed equitably within each program)
  • Facilitates the prompt submission of reports, forms, and fees due to the CIF, CCS, and PSAL
  • Ensures title IX is being adhered to and that the school is in compliance in terms of gender equity
  • Approves and assists in the planning and execution of trips pertaining to athletic activities
  • Coordinates school-provided student transportation
  • Represents the school at sectional and league meetings
  • Adheres to league, section, state, and school requirements of eligibility for participation
  • Develops and creates systems for schedules for games, practices, meetings, traveling that are equitable amongst all parties involved
  • Ensures equitable access for all programs in regards to facilities, funds, and attention from the AD
  • Plans and executes seasonal events to celebrate students and the community when it comes to athletic and academic performances
  • Updates and communicates athletics news through calendars, social media and website platforms to promote school spirit and celebrate students
  • Runs systems for Academic Reports and reviews and communicates to coaches and families regarding student eligibility
  • Promotes an atmosphere of cooperation and teamwork
  • Develops teamwork, morale, sportsmanship, courtesy, fair play, academic excellence, and strict adherence to the rules of training and conduct
  • Promotes the attitude among athletes and coaches that winning is important but is secondary to good sportsmanship and the overall welfare of the athlete
  • Represents the school in an exemplary fashion
  • Always acts in the best interest of students and manages disciplinary systems within each team and whole department consistent with the mission of the athletics program
  • Continues to develop professionally and learn best practices of being an athletic administrator through NIAAA and other organizations
  • Promotes health and safety guidelines in accordance with KIPP King and League regulations
  • Obtains/maintains required NFHS and First Aid/CPR certifications required by the PSAL and CIF
  • Completes required safety training for basic first aid and injury prevention available through SafeSchools and NFHS
  • Monitors student-athlete academic progress, eligibility, and graduation readiness.
  • Partners with counselors, teachers, and families to provide support for student-athletes.
  • Promotes a culture where academics come first and athletics serves as a pathway to college and career success.
  • Partners with school leadership to use athletics as a strategy for student recruitment, retention, and community engagement.
  • Builds relationships with local schools, youth sports programs, and community organizations to expand participation and awareness of SFCP.
  • Supports recruitment events, family outreach, and summer engagement opportunities to help achieve enrollment goals.
